I swear by Holloway House as I have hard wood floors throughout the living level of our house.
Holloway products can be found at some Walgreens, and at hardware stores.
I use their floor wash, then the Quick Shine to give floors a nice shimmer.
Between washings, I also use their Quick Fix to eliminate spills, light scratches. These also work wonderfully on tiles and linoleum, making them look like glass (if they're not too warn).
